范围:十进制 8704-8959,十六进制 2200-22FF。
如果您想要在 HTML 中显示这些字符,您可以使用下表中的 HTML 实体。
如果字符没有 HTML 实体,您可以使用十进制或十六进制引用。

并非下表中的所有实体都能在所有的浏览器中正确地显示。
目前,IE 11 是唯一一个能正确显示所有 HTML5 实体的浏览器。
